Kenneth ‘Wayne’ Bullock, passed away quietly at home in Raymond, Alberta on Friday, December 14, 2018.
Wayne was born June 22, 1943 in Lethbridge, Alberta to Glen Curtis Bullock and Anna LaVaun (nee Peterson) Bullock of Raymond, Alberta.
Wayne was predeceased by his parents. He is survived by his wife Karen (nee Tustian), his children; Krista (Anthony) Nai, Karma (Michael) Heninger, Kasson (Renee) Bullock and Kendra (Doug) Tanner, and also 13 grandchildren. He also leaves behind three siblings; Carol (Bill) Bennett, Glenda (Ellis) Stonehacker and Reid (Nancy) Bullock.
Wayne graduated from BYU with a Master’s Degree in Library Science and spent his professional career working for the Calgary Board of Education as a Librarian. He had a passion for history and a love of reading and poetry. He also graduated with a Bachelor’s Degree in Genealogy. This education sparked a life-long devotion of researching family history and connecting families together in this life and the next. We know he is with those family members now. He also served a two year mission in California teaching the deaf for The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ints.
This gentle, quiet man will be loved and missed by all who had the privilege of knowing him.
